Transaction 2e597358cb11eb68d4721219cf786ed86cc549bcde08ba9c12fc63f98eb3e42e

1 Input
2 Outputs
  • 2e597358cb11eb68d4721219cf786ed86cc549bcde08ba9c12fc63f98eb3e42e:0
  • value  22611966
    address  3HYoWWfrbfbhQxoDhGUEFwxp2TyfDJLJhq
  • 2e597358cb11eb68d4721219cf786ed86cc549bcde08ba9c12fc63f98eb3e42e:1
  • value  23300667
    address  1541KkRKAt6qUfxpigvavxivUEXr1aanBY